WebA modal share (also called mode split, mode-share, or modal split) is the percentage of travelers using a particular type of transportation or number of trips using said type. In freight transportation, this may be measured in mass.. Modal share is an important component in developing sustainable transport within a city or region. Given the region's aggressive 2015 mode … WebMode split goals shall be based on the performance targets from Policy 9.49.3 in the Transportation System Plan; 2. An ECO survey submitted in Subsection B. shall serve as the baseline mode split, when available. If an ECO survey is not available, census data may be used, or the applicant may submit an independent survey from a professional ... WebJul 21, 2024 · For the past eight years one of the strongest organizing principles for Portland-area bike advocates has been the stated goal of having 25 percent of commute trips made by bike by the year 2030. Now, in what appears to be a sign of backpedaling, the City of Portland wants to decrease the bike commute mode share target to just 15 …
